In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ding TN10 4RG,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 53.5%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.
| 2011 | 2021 | 10y change (pp) | UK Average | postcode vs UK (pp)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Female | 51.1% | 53.5% | 2.4% | 51.0% | 2.5% |
| Male | 48.9% | 46.5% | -2.4% | 49.0% | -2.5% |
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.
In the immediate vicinity of TN10 4RG there is a very large concentration of residents that are married - 56.9% of the resident population. In contrast, the average marriage rate across the census is about 44%.
Areas with a high percentage of married residents are typically suburban neighborhoods, towns with good schools and family-friendly amenities, and regions with affordable, spacious housing options. Additionally, such areas can be popular among retirees.
| 2011 | 2021 | 10y change (pp) | UK Average | postcode vs UK (pp)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Single | 23.8% | 26.5% | 2.7% | 37.9% | -11.4% |
| Married: Opposite sex | 60.6% | 56.9% | -3.7% | 44.2% | 12.7% |
| Separated | 2.2% | 0.3% | -1.9% | 2.2% | -1.9% |
| Divorced | 5.7% | 6.8% | 1.1% | 9.1% | -2.3% |
| Widowed | 7.6% | 9.5% | 1.9% | 6.1% | 3.4% |

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Whistler Road was 44.4 per 1,000 residents, which is 49.3% lower than the Cage Green & Angel average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.
Whistler Road has the 49th lowest crime rate of 104 local areas in Cage Green & Angel and the 198th lowest crime rate of 404 local areas in Tonbridge and Malling .
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 15.7 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-53.0%.
